isabele lucas the face of tourism victoria

August 19, 2009

Check out some shots from the Lead a Double Life campaign from Visit Victoria. You can check out the full commercial here (very beautiful!).  The television commercial kicked off a couple of days ago. Featuring Isabel Lucas, the advertisement explores the Daylesford and Macedon Ranges region with Lucas looking ethereal by day while strolling through the countryside. Makes me desperately want to go to Daylesford, with the advertisement showing the romantic landscape with an Autumnal feel.

isabel-lucas-daylesford-copy

The Double Life aspect involves Lucas reflecting on her decadent night before, with a full feast designed by chef and owner of The Lakehouse in Daylesford.  I love the scene of her scoffing berries at night with her hands and stuffing her face (might be something to do with the fact that it reminds me somewhat of yours truly’s own eating habits).

50s lingerie

July 14, 2009

 dior-copy

Underwear as overwear trend is hardly a new theme, however in Paris at the Haute Couture shows last week John Galliano’s show for Dior was particularly inspired. Models walked the runway in various stages of undress showing peekaboo glimpses of beautiful 50s style lingerie. The shows was inspired by photographs taken behind the scenes of Mr Christian Dior himself backstage in the 1950s. Beautiful hourglass silhouettes were emphasised with tailored jackets, full skirts in vibrant shades of fuschia, orange, yellow and red. serena van der woodson

February 24, 2009

story-copy

I am obsessed with all things Gossip Girl at the moment. I have to confess every time I shop I have to ask myself ‘would Serena wear this?’ – god I love that show. Anyway according to the show’s costume designer Eric Daman, Serena’s look is the most difficult to put together. Inspired by Kate Moss, the roll-out-of-bed appearance which Serena stands for is hard to achieve – a look which is effortless but simultaneously stunning.
